Fishing tournament:  Kay Dunkin and Elissa Vann presented some details about the tournament.  It will be May 6 at El Jefe’s in Port Mansfield .There will be a Calcutta and registration on May 5 at Baloo’s.  Cost is $400.00 per boat.  Fishing will begin at 5:00 AM, weigh in at 3:30.  Prizes will be awarded to best boat and best male and female total.

There will be a fish fry dinner following, as well as a raffle.  Winner need not be present.

The committee will meet again Tuesday Feb. 21 at the League office.  All are welcome to attend.

Relay for Life date is April 7-8.  Theme:  “Toon out Cancer”.  Our theme will be Superwoman (Superheros) to go with our president’s theme for year.  Wear JLH Superwoman shirts or League shirts.  We will order more superwoman shirts if needed. Walkers needed to raise at least $100.00 each for team sponsorship. We will be partnering with Dana Carter’s kids from Calvary Christian school to share costs of team, decorations and tents.  This will also boost our presence.  Luminaries can be purchased for $5.00 each.  Opening Ceremony will be 5:30 p.m. April 7, first lap at 6:00 p.m.
